Why Prune Your Trees?
Our experienced team uses industry-best practices to ensure the health and longevity of your trees. We offer a variety of pruning techniques tailored to meet the specific needs of each tree species and situation:
Deadwood Removal: Eliminates dead or dying branches to prevent decay and disease spread.
Crown Thinning: Removes excess branches to improve air circulation and sunlight penetration.
Crown Raising: Elevates the lower branches to provide clearance and enhance the view.
Crown Reduction: Reduces the overall size of the tree for space management and structural integrity.

The frequency of tree pruning depends on the species of the tree, its age, and its health. Generally, pruning is done every 1-3 years to maintain tree health, shape, and safety. Our team can assess your trees and provide a tailored pruning schedule based on their specific needs.

Yes, we offer stump grinding services to remove stumps left after tree removal. This process grinds the stump down below ground level, allowing you to reclaim the space for other uses and improving the overall appearance of your landscape.
